John Hillson: The following year 1956-57 the team lost one game in the semi -final of the sheild. The following week we beat the same team in the Totty cup final and never lost in the league. We never had a pitch of our own, we played on the Dearne ground for our home matches at Goldthorpe. We practised on the waste ground opposite Highgate greyhound stadium.
